Overview

The Disability Law Center of Alaska’s video library offers a rich collection of educational and advocacy-focused content designed to empower individuals with disabilities and their families. Covering topics such as supported decision-making, employment rights, voting access, and self-advocacy, these videos provide practical guidance and real-life examples to help youth with disabilities navigate the transition to adult life. 

Description

This video resource hub features curated playlists including “Know Your Rights,” “Supported Decision-Making Agreements,” and “Alaska’s Shared Vision,” among others. Each video is designed to inform and inspire self-advocates, educators, and families by addressing legal rights, community inclusion, and pathways to independence. With accessible formats including ASL interpretation, audio description, and open captions, the DLC video library ensures that critical information is available to all. These videos are a valuable tool for planning, learning, and building confidence during the transition from school to adulthood.
